Overview The individual working in production / light assembly at our clothing manufacturing facility is responsible for tagging garment pieces, separating different parts of the garment, determining if all pieces are included and correct, recording jobs that enter the sew shop and helping move production in our cutting department. Responsibilities Checking to be sure all garment pieces are included Tagging individual pieces Use scissors to hand cut small parts Assembling cut pieces into correct bundles for production in sewing department Operating fusing machine (will train) Operating apparel cutting machine (will train)
